- Abstract: The different morphologies of grain boundary proeutectoid pearlite formed in 100Mn13 steel, which was conducted by solution treatment at 1050 ℃ and followed by aging treatment respectively at 475 ℃ and 500 ℃, were studied by transmission electron microscope. The results show that the proeutectoid phase formed at austenite grain boundary is the pearlite composed of carbide and ferrite after low temperature aging treatment, rather than one phase of carbide or ferrite which currently is widely considered. And there are two kinds of growth mechanisms for the grain boundary proeutectoid pearlite as follows: (1) The grain boundary proeutectoid pearlite consists of one layer of carbides and one layer of ferrite jointly arranged continuously along grain boundary, the carbides are M3 C+M7 C3 mixed carbides, which is the leading phase of pearlite precipitation. (2) The grain boundary proeutectoid pearlite makes up short rod-like carbides and short rod-like ferrites arranged alternately along grain boundary, the carbide is M3 C carbide.
